S3, обслуживающий mpeg-dash, загрузит манифест, но CORS не сможет работать с пакетами - PullRequest
0 голосов
/ 22 октября 2018

Я использую S3 для показа видео в формате MPEG-Dash, и он работает нормально.

Я внес некоторые изменения в задания по обработке видео, но они все еще публикуются в том же месте, но теперь у меня возникает странная проблема, когда манифест (в той же папке) загружается нормально, ноЯ получаю следующую ошибку:

Ответ на запрос предварительной проверки не проходит проверку контроля доступа: в запрошенном ресурсе отсутствует заголовок «Access-Control-Allow-Origin».Поэтому для источника 'https://localhost:3000' доступ запрещен.

S3 настроен по следующему правилу

<CORSRule>
    <AllowedOrigin>https://localhost:3000</AllowedOrigin>
    <AllowedMethod>GET</AllowedMethod>
    <AllowedMethod>PUT</AllowedMethod>
    <AllowedMethod>POST</AllowedMethod>
    <AllowedMethod>DELETE</AllowedMethod>
    <AllowedHeader>*</AllowedHeader>
</CORSRule>

и никогда ранее не создавал проблем.

URL-адреса прекрасно загружаются в браузере, поэтому они действительны.

Я не получаю никаких ответов, когда смотрю в инструменте отладки, нет ответа, но это код состояния 403

1 Ответ

0 голосов
/ 22 октября 2018

Проблема была в неправильной настройке локального тестируемого прокси-сервера

...